I have a little 80 like that Fish.  @basfnb's brother gave it to me.  Wouldn't start.  Turned out the intake valve had gotten tight so with a valve adjustment it cranked up.  Smokes like a chimney though. 

 

I ordered a cheap top end for it and hope to get it done over the winter, not that I'll need it anytime soon since the baby is only 18 months.
